Report description

This report analyses some of the latest developments and innovations in the apparel industry, including environmentally friendly dyeing technology, environmentally friendly fibres and apparel, fibres and yarns for apparel, finishing treatments, moisture management fibres, sizing tools, temperature regulating apparel, textile printing and textile recycling machinery. The report includes news from the following innovative companies and other organisations: Adidas, ColorZen, Cone & Burlington Apparel Solutions, Dow Microbial Control, Digitl Ink, DyeCoo Textile Systems, the Engineering and Physical Sciences Research Council (EPSRC), Filatura di Saluzzo, the Hohenstein Institute, Lenzing, London College of Fashion, Marks and Spencer (M&S), Ministry of Supply, Textiles for Textiles (T4T), Trevira, The University of Sheffield, and Yeh Group.
